About J. S. Bailey

J. S. Bailey is a scholar working on Soil Science, Plant Science, Environmental Chemistry, Environmental Engineering and Biomaterials, having authored 71 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(29 papers), Soil and Water Nutrient Dynamics (22 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(12 papers), Soil Geostatistics and Mapping (9 papers), Clay minerals and soil interactions (9 papers), Banana Cultivation and Research (8 papers), Soil erosion and sediment transport (7 papers) and Soil and Unsaturated Flow (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(741 citations), Environmental Chemistry (469 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(228 citations), Agronomy and Crop Science (188 citations) and Environmental Engineering (220 citations). J. S. Bailey has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Alan F. Wright, R. H. Foy, C. Jordan, Philip J. White, Jonathan E. Holland, Richard C. Hayes, Dario Fornara, Robin J. Pakeman, A. C. Newton and Blair M. McKenzie. Their work appears in journals such as Soil Use and Management, Plant and Soil, Journal of Crystal Growth, Precision Agriculture and New Phytologist.
